Spin the Cradle

The Newton's Cradle likely spends most of the school year collecting dust. Adding this will diminish the accumulation a little bit.

Center that cradle on a low-friction turntable, and you've got the makings of a nice demonstration for AP Physics 1. There's a classic uniform circular motion free-body diagram to be solved. And the solution speaks to the angle a ball will swing to when things are set into motion.

A curious counter-intuitive interpretation of the mathematics is explored. It's nerdy stuff, appropriate for the more deeply-set plow we use in the advanced level high school course.
